Transport Consultation - Cross Lane Dunston - Prohibition of Driving
Notice is hereby given that following the experimental traffic order relating to Cross Lane Dunston made in June 2022, the Council are proposing to introduce The Borough Council of Gateshead (Cross Lane, Dunston) Traffic Regulation Order.
***This proposal was originally advertised on the 13 October 2023. The notice of Intention and Schedule to the draft Order have been revised to clarify that the proposed prohibition affects both northbound and southbound traffic along the section of road described.****
The proposed order will revoke the 2022 experimental traffic order and introduce a prohibiton of driving along Cross Lane, Dunston as further described in the Notice of Intention attached to this consultation and can be found below.
The draft Order together with a plan and a statement of the Council’s reasons for proposing to make the Order may be examined online at the information desk on the ground floor reception of Gateshead Council’s Civic Centre, Regent Street, Gateshead NE8 1HH, Monday to Thursday between 8.45am and 5.00pm and Friday between 8.45am and 4.30pm or online at: www.gateshead.gov.uk/trafficschemes (Ref: IKEN/015903).
If you wish to object to the proposed Order you should send the grounds for your objection in writing to be received by the undersigned at the above address on or before 01 December 2023. NOTE - If you have already submitted a representation and your views remain the same, you do not need to submit a further representation. Previously received responses will be considered when the Council make their decision regarding the proposal.
